During his NWA days, Ice Cube was, shall we say, not circumspect about his views on the LA police force. We knew his opinions vis-a-vis the law enforcement group. But like Ice-T in New Jack City, it looks like Cube will be crossing the thin blue line to play a cop in Rampart, co-starring with Woody Harrelson and Ben Foster in Oren Moverman's film of James Elroy's script.

While he'll be playing a muthafucka in a blue uniform with the authority to kill a minority, you can see the appeal, since Rampart is based on a real-life scandal involving corruption within the LAPD in the 1990s. And that's corruption like bank robbery and drug dealing. Not, like, stealing the LAPD stationery. Cube's role is the good cop, investigating dirty cop Harrelson.

Only a couple of weeks ago Rampart was still just a mooted project, with nobody officially signed. Deadline's story this morning suggests that it's now a properly going concern, officially reuniting the Messenger team of Harrelson, Foster and Moverman, and going before the cameras in the summer.
